British A 1945 Dated Large / Shallow Mug
British Army tin mugs come in a variety of colours, but generally speaking they are of the same shape. One design from the end of World War Two however differs and the mug is much wider but shallower than other designs
The base of the mug is W /| D marked, dated 1945 and has a maker’s name of Jury
These mugs have been associated with jungle use read more

WWII US 9th U.S.A.A.F Air Force Patch
USAAF (United States American Air Force) 9th Air Force shoulder patch. The 9th AF participated in Egypt and Libya, the campaign in Tunisia, and the invasions of Sicily and Italy. The 9th transferred to England in October, 1943 and participated in Normandy invasion and the rest of the European continent until the VE-Day. read more

WW2 US Airborne Command Crest Insignia Pinback
Before troopers of the 506th and 501st ever wore the screaming eagle patch on their left shoulder, they wore the Airborne Command patch
for small units not yet assigned to a division, the Airborne Command patch was created for small, non-divisional Airborne units read more
